What is the 2023 Form 990 Exempt Organization Return?

The 2023 Form 990 serves as a critical tax document for exempt organizations in the United States. Its primary purpose is to report financial activities and ensure compliance with regulations set forth by the IRS. Organizations that qualify for tax-exempt status must file this form to maintain their eligibility. Failing to submit Form 990 can jeopardize an organization’s tax-exempt status, making timely filing essential for compliance.

Purpose and Benefits of Filing the 2023 Form 990 Exempt Organization Return

The Form 990 aims to promote transparency and accountability among nonprofit organizations. By providing detailed financial information, it helps these organizations demonstrate their compliance with federal regulations. Filing this tax exempt form offers several benefits, including enhanced credibility among donors and stakeholders. Moreover, accurate reporting reduces the risk of penalties, ensuring that organizations remain in good standing with the IRS.

Who Needs the 2023 Form 990 Exempt Organization Return?

Various types of organizations are required to file the 2023 Form 990. Typically, larger nonprofits that exceed certain revenue thresholds must submit this form. Smaller exempt organizations may qualify for different filing requirements, such as shorter forms or exemptions altogether. It is crucial for organizations to assess their eligibility and understand the specific criteria that determine whether they need to file.

Key Features of the 2023 Form 990 Exempt Organization Return

The 2023 Form 990 contains several key sections that provide a comprehensive overview of an organization's financial health. Major components include detailed accounts of revenue, expenses, and program services. Additionally, the form requires signatures from both the President and the Preparer, crucial for validating the submission. This information is invaluable not only to the IRS but also to the public, fostering trust in nonprofit operations.

The 2023 Form 990 is intended for tax-exempt organizations in the U.S. that meet IRS requirements. This includes charities, educational institutions, and other nonprofit entities.
The deadline for filing the 2023 Form 990 is typically the 15th day of the 5th month after the end of the organization’s tax year. Make sure to confirm based on accounting periods.
You can submit the 2023 Form 990 electronically through the IRS e-file system or by mailing a hard copy to the appropriate IRS address, depending on your organization's preference.
In general, supporting documents may include financial statements, detailed revenue breakdowns, and other relevant information that reflect the organization's activities for the reporting year.
Common mistakes include incomplete sections, incorrect financial figures, and missing signatures from the President and Preparer. Ensure clarity and thoroughness with all information provided.
Processing times for the Form 990 can vary, but it typically takes several weeks for the IRS to process submitted forms. Check for e-filing updates for quicker acknowledgments.
No, notarization is not required for the Form 990. However, it does require appropriate signatures from the President and the Preparer before submission.
